A Lagos court has ordered the release of 17-year-old Quadri Yusuf Alabi, the teenager who became popular during the 2023 general elections after standing in front of the convoy of Labour Party presidential candidate, Mr. Peter Obi.

Quadri, who was controversially charged with armed robbery, was discharged and freed on Wednesday, April 17, 2025.

Quadri had been remanded at the Medium Security Custodial Centre, Kirikiri, following a complaint filed by officers of the Amukoko Divisional Police Headquarters (Pako Police Station) on January 26, 2025.

According to a statement released by his legal representative, Inibehe Effiong, Esq., the teenager was abducted by two well-known “Area Boys” — identified as Lege and Baba Waris — while returning from work near his family residence in Amukoko, Ajeromi-Ifelodun Local Government Area of Lagos State.

“They dumped him at the police station and falsely accused him of street fighting,” Effiong explained. “To the utter shock of his family, the police later arraigned him before a Magistrate on a trumped-up charge of armed robbery.”

The statement, which was signed by Effiong, revealed that Quadri had faced harassment from community thugs who were envious of the donations he received after the viral incident in 2023.

His family was allegedly pressured by the local Baale to cook food for the area boys as a form of appeasement — an offer they could not fulfill.

Effiong stated: “The police officers, in their bid to validate the false charge, fraudulently joined Quadri with four strange adults and misrepresented his age as 18, despite knowing he was a minor.”

The intervention came after Ms. Hassana Nurudeen, Co-founder of Ray of Hope Prison Outreach, brought the matter to public attention. Quadri’s mother then reached out to Effiong, who escalated the case promptly.

Delivering judgment, the presiding Magistrate, His Honour, A.O. Olorunfemi (Mrs.), said the Director of Public Prosecutions (DPP), Dr. Babajide Martins of the Lagos State Ministry of Justice, advised against prosecuting Quadri, having found no evidence of the alleged crime.

“In his legal advice, the DPP concluded that the allegation of armed robbery against our client was baseless,” Effiong noted. “We commend the DPP for standing by the truth.”

In his reaction, Effiong called on the Nigeria Police Force to urgently discipline all officers involved in the wrongful detention, including the Divisional Police Officer of Amukoko and the Investigating Police Officer, Inspector Odigbe Samuel.

“We are demanding the sum of One Hundred Million Naira (N100,000,000.00) in compensation for our client, a public apology from the Police, and disciplinary action against all erring officers.”

“If these remedial steps are not taken, we shall institute legal proceedings to seek redress,” Effiong declared.

He added: “Quadri’s ordeal reflects the deep-rooted impunity, corruption, and rot within the Nigerian Police Force. There are many other young Nigerians like Quadri languishing in detention for crimes they never committed.”

The statement concluded with a strong warning: “History will vindicate the just.”
